Abstract

The purpose of this study was to improve the high jump with a method of learning to play in coastalenvironments are students actively engaged in learning activities and encourage students to be more creative,foster self-confidence in learning. The method used in this research is Classroom Action Research (CAR). Theresearch was conducted at SMP Negeri 1 Warureja Tegal regency, the research subjects were students of classVIII B, amounting to 37 students.Data was collected through observation, tests and questionnaires. Forqualitative data analysis used observations of student activity sheets and questionnaires are used to determinestudents' responses, while quantitative data using the test, to determine student learning outcomes. ClassroomAction Research (CAR), there are two cycles with the same subject matter, where each cycle consists of fourphases: planning, action, observation and reflection. Results also showed an increase in student learning arepretty good views of the average student learning outcomes of each cycle. Average student learning outcomesfirst cycle of 7.80 and the second cycle of 8. This is reinforced by the students' response to the application of themethod to the beach to play in the presentation of cycle 1 and cycle 2 64.86% 92.43%. These results indicate anincrease in students' learning activities are quite high
